The .300 Winchester Magnum emerged as a powerhouse in the world of big-game hunting. It was developed by Winchester Repeating Arms Company in the early 1960s. The original goal was to create a cartridge that could deliver exceptional performance in a standard-length action rifle. This meant achieving high velocities and flat trajectories with heavier bullets, making it a versatile choice for various game animals, from deer to elk to even larger, tougher creatures. The .300 WM quickly gained popularity, thanks to its impressive ballistics and the widespread availability of rifles and ammunition. It provided hunters with a significant upgrade in range and power compared to existing .30-caliber offerings.

The .30 Nosler is a relative newcomer to the scene. Developed by Nosler, a renowned bullet manufacturer, the .30 Nosler’s inception was based on a desire to optimize performance and address the perceived limitations of some existing magnum cartridges. Its design aimed at maximizing ballistic potential, specifically by utilizing a longer case to accommodate more propellant and achieving even higher velocities. This would result in a flatter trajectory and extended effective range compared to its peers. The cartridge represents a modern approach to cartridge design, emphasizing precision and ballistic efficiency.

Ballistics: Understanding the Numbers

Velocity is King

The .30 Nosler typically provides a marginal velocity advantage over the .300 WM. This means that, with similar bullet weights, the .30 Nosler will propel the bullet at a slightly higher speed. This difference, while seemingly small, translates to noticeable advantages at longer ranges. Some reports show the .30 Nosler delivering velocities close to 3,200 feet per second (fps) with a 180-grain bullet, while the .300 WM may reach around 3,100 fps. The variance depends on the specific loading, barrel length, and other factors.

Energy at Impact

The higher velocity of the .30 Nosler does translate into slightly higher muzzle energy. Energy at impact, however, declines over distance. Both cartridges deliver substantial energy downrange, sufficient for taking down even large game. It’s worth mentioning that, while velocity is important, the efficiency of the bullet’s design (its ballistic coefficient) also heavily influences how well the bullet maintains its velocity and energy over distance.

Trajectory: The Path of Flight

A flatter trajectory is highly desirable for long-range shooting. The .30 Nosler, with its higher velocities, will generally exhibit a slightly flatter trajectory. This means the bullet will drop less over distance. This flatter trajectory translates to less holdover (aiming above the target) at longer ranges, making it easier to achieve accurate shots. The .300 WM, while still offering a relatively flat trajectory, will require slightly more elevation compensation at extended ranges.

Bullet Flight Stability: Ballistic Coefficient Matters

The ballistic coefficient (BC) is a measure of a bullet’s ability to overcome air resistance. A higher BC means the bullet is more aerodynamic and retains its velocity better over distance. The .30 Nosler’s higher velocities combined with its bullets designed for long range shooting means it can utilize high BC bullets. The .300 WM also uses high BC bullets, providing excellent wind resistance and long-range capabilities.

Fighting the Wind

Wind drift is a significant challenge for long-range shooters. The .30 Nosler, with its higher velocity and (potentially) better bullet design, may be less affected by wind drift compared to the .300 WM. But in real-world conditions, both cartridges are susceptible to wind, and accurate wind estimation is crucial for successful long-range shots.

Practical Applications and Hunting Scenarios

The ideal cartridge for your hunting expedition depends on your quarry and preferred shooting distances. For elk, moose, or large bear hunting at extended ranges (300+ yards), the .30 Nosler’s flat trajectory and higher velocity can provide an edge. Its ability to launch heavier, high-BC bullets can increase the likelihood of a clean, ethical kill. However, the .300 WM remains a perfectly viable choice for these same game animals.

For deer hunting or scenarios where shots are typically taken at moderate ranges (200-400 yards), either cartridge will perform exceptionally well. The .300 WM’s wider availability and the diversity of available ammunition make it a very strong option for many hunters.

Rifle selection is crucial. Both cartridges work well in bolt-action rifles, the standard platform for long-range hunting. Consider the rifle’s weight, barrel length, and recoil management features (like a muzzle brake) to find the best balance for your needs. A rifle with proper recoil mitigation will make your shooting experience more pleasant and help you maintain accuracy.

Reloading allows you to fine-tune your ammunition to maximize your rifle’s performance. Careful selection of the right bullets and powders, based on your rifle’s characteristics, is crucial for optimal accuracy and consistency. Both cartridges offer robust reloading support, with plentiful data and component availability.

Cost: Weighing the Expenses

The cost of ammunition plays a role in making your decision. Factory ammunition for the .30 Nosler generally costs more than ammunition for the .300 WM. The prices of components, such as bullets, primers, and powders, will also vary. Overall, reloading for the .300 WM can prove less expensive than reloading for the .30 Nosler. Consider your budget and shooting frequency when comparing these two cartridges.
